Contributions to Fund and rates of contribution S.I. No. 34 of 2010 20. (1) A licensee shall contribute, in accordance with section seventy of the Act, at the rate not exceeding 1.5 percent of gross annual turnover collected by the Authority under the Information and Communications Technologies (Licensing) Regulations, 2010. (2) A contribution made under sub-regulation (1), shall not exceed fifty percent of the total collectable annual operating fees payable to the Authority. (3) Contributions payable by a licensee under this regulation shall be payable annually in advance and shall be effected by payment to the Authority. (4) The Fund may receive moneys from appropriations from Parliament, grants, donations and other sources. (5) The money received by the fund under subregulation (4) shall be deposited in the Fund account and shall form part of the moneys accruing to or otherwise vesting in the fund. Application for funds 21. (1) A universal service provider wishing to develop any un-served or under-served area may apply to the Authority for money to develop that area: Provided that the money from the Fund shall only be used to carry out development which has been approved by the Authority. (2) The application referred to in subregulation (1) shall be in writing and shall contain the following particulars: (a) the development proposal; (b) the name of the un-served or under-served area for which the development proposal is to be implemented; (c) the estimated cost of the development that the universal access provider wishes to undertake; (d) a plan for the implementation of the development proposal; and (e) a plan for the future operation and maintenance of the development and how the development will be financed.
